C6 Transmission Mount problem

I have a 1972 F100 with a freshly rebuilt 390 and C6 Auto Trans. I'm about to put the engine and trans back into the truck, and I have had a real hard time finding a new transmission mount that has the holes that mount onto the Trans that are drilled in the right spot. They are either aligned just right, but not centered on the bracket, or just way off entirely. I have gone through LMC, O'reily's, NAPA, and a small mom n pop place. NAPA sent me one with the holes slotted so there's wiggle room, but the mount is about a quarter of an inch shorter than the one I have, and quite honestly just not as beefy. I'm about to just drill new holes in the proper spot and deal with a slotted connection. Anyone else come across this. Just a little frustrated..

C6TZ-6068-F .. Transmission Mount (steel/rubber insulator) / Obsolete

1966/67 F100 352 M/T 4WD / 1967 F250 352 M/T 4WD / 1967 F350 352 MX C-O-M / 1968/72 F100/250 360 M/T 4WD / 1968/72 F100/250 2WD & F350 360/390 C6 / 1968/72 F350 360/390 M/T.

Rabbit, The C6 is a single piece bell & case unit. There are 3 different bell patterns, the FE, small block W,C, and 385 series 429/460.

A round top FE bell should mate up to your FE 390 engine with no issues.
